Surrogate mother definition is - a woman who becomes pregnant by artificial insemination or by implantation of a fertilized egg created by in vitro fertilization for the purpose of carrying the fetus to term for another person or persons. Costs of Surrogacy Surrogacy can be an expensive process, with costs ranging anywhere from $15,000 to $100,000 for the entire process. In general, a “successful surrogacy journey” (meaning one that ends with a delivery) will cost $75,000 to over $100,000, plus costs associated with making embryos, says Sgambati.
